Calle Ocho doesn't slow down for anyone, and this tour leans right into it. In two hours, you'll eat, sip, and stroll through the landmarks, flavours, and living history that make Little Havana the true soul of Miami. It starts at the Bay of Pigs Monument, where the stories of the 1960s Cuban migration set the scene. From there, the neighbourhood unfolds: colourful Rooster sculptures, the José Martí Memorial, the Map of Cuba, and Domino Park, where Celia Cruz and Gloria Estefan have their place on the Walk of Fame. Then the food takes over. Fresh Guarapo juice at a neighbourhood fruteria, flaky guava pastelitos and ham croquetas from a family-run bakery, a punchy Cuban coffee, crispy mariquitas, and a perfectly pressed Cuban sandwich. The tour closes watching master cigar rollers at work, a craft as much a part of Calle Ocho as the food itself. Book a spot in a small group, or make it yours entirely.
